Methods for Efficient Freezing
Instead of freezing entire lemons, cut them into slices or wedges for best results. A combination of salt and agave may enhance the taste of tequila, and finely cut wedges can be used to add zest to a variety of recipes. Keep these lemon wedges in an airtight freezer bag for easy retrieval of the needed amount. If you want to use them in your recipes right away, thaw them first by using the defrost function on your microwave or letting them sit in the sun for a few minutes.
